Dรฉtails du cours

โ€ข Introduction to Cyber Security for Energy: Understanding the importance of cyber security in the energy sector, common threats and challenges. โ€ข Best Practices for Energy Infrastructure Security: Implementing strong access controls, physical security measures, and network segmentation. โ€ข Cyber Threat Intelligence for Energy: Monitoring and analyzing cyber threats, identifying potential vulnerabilities, and implementing proactive security measures. โ€ข Incident Response and Disaster Recovery: Developing incident response plans, implementing disaster recovery strategies, and conducting regular drills. โ€ข Secure Data Management for Energy: Implementing data encryption, secure data storage, and backup procedures. โ€ข Identity and Access Management for Energy: Managing user identities, implementing multi-factor authentication, and controlling access to critical systems and data. โ€ข Security Awareness Training for Energy: Providing regular security awareness training to employees, contractors, and third-party vendors. โ€ข Supply Chain Security for Energy: Implementing supplier risk assessments, monitoring third-party vendors, and establishing secure supply chain practices. โ€ข Regulatory Compliance for Energy Cyber Security: Understanding and complying with relevant regulations, standards, and best practices for energy cyber security.
